IDF Claims Hamas Commander Killed in Gaza: UNRWA Staff Member Involved?

The Israeli Defence Forces (IDF) has reportedly killed a Hamas commander, Mohammad Abu Itiwi, who was also a staff member of the United Nations Relief and Works Agency for Palestine Refugees in the Near East (UNRWA). The IDF claims Itiwi was involved in the abduction and murder of Israeli civilians. UNRWA has not confirmed or denied the allegations.

In related news, US and Israeli negotiators are expected to meet in Doha to restart talks on a ceasefire deal and hostage release in Gaza. The meeting comes after the death of Hamas leader Yahya Sinwar, who was seen as an obstacle to a deal.
